FLIR thermal imaging cameras revolutionize the way we perceive our world. Unlike traditional devices that capture visible light, FLIR cameras detect infrared radiation emitted by objects. This allows us to pinpoint temperature differences, even in low-light conditions. Whether you're a professional in fields like security or simply interested about exploring the unseen world, FLIR thermal imaging offers a remarkable perspective.
- Examples of FLIR cameras are vast and varied:
- Finding heat loss in buildings
- Inspecting electrical equipment for overheating
- Identifying wildlife in their natural habitats
- Assisting search and rescue operations

Exploring the Invisible: FLIR Thermal Imaging
The world we perceive is limited by our eyes, which can only detect a narrow band of electromagnetic radiation known as visible light. However, beyond this visible spectrum lies a wealth of information hidden in infrared (IR) radiation, which emits heat energy. Thermal imaging systems leverage this power, revealing temperature variations invisible to the human eye. This astonishing technology has revolutionized numerous fields, from search and rescue operations to medical diagnosis. By detecting these minute heat differences, FLIR cameras offer a unique perspective on our surroundings, enabling users to identify anomalies, monitor performance, and improve efficiency in ways never before possible.
